Titanic 3D releases on 5th April 2012

Producer of the most important blockbusters in movie history ‘Titanic’ & ‘Avatar’ in India with Oscar!Producer Jon Landau in India for a whirlwind 2 city tour in March 2012

The most spectacular cinematic event of 2012, the discharge of James Cameron and Fox Star Studios magnum opus Titanic 3D has set sail in magnificent style as Producer Jon Landau has flown down for a grand India tour and is in Mumbai today for a different visit! The person behind two of the most important grossers in movie history (Titanic and Avatar), Jon Landau will visit Mumbai and Delhi three weeks sooner than the much awaited release of Titanic 3D. What’s more, the prestigious producer has brought a unprecedented memento all of the way from Hollywood: the celebrated Oscar statuette he won for Titanic in 1997!

Speaking at the exciting visit is Mr Vijay Singh, CEO, Fox Star Studios India, “We are extremely happy to host Mr. Landau in India. There's huge excitement for Titanic 3D in India, with an unprecedented 25 Lac fans from India at the Titanic 3D global Facebook page, that's actually the No.1 fan base around the World.”

Speaking at the phenomenon of Titanic 3D, Mr. Jon Landau quotes, “The themes of TITANIC are as relevant today as they were 15 years ago. I FEEL people who have seen the film will find them transported in a brand new way; but therewill even be many discovering the film for the primary time, who weren’t even born when it was released in 1997. Audiences old and young are each going to take something clear of it.”

Opening across theatres on 5th April 2012 in India in English, Hindi, Tamil and Telegu, the film’s 3D release is a commemoration of the 100th anniversary of the sinking of the Titanic, and pays a distinct tribute to the tragedy that happened in 1912. Probably the most celebrated film in history might be presented to audiences in 3D format by James Cameron who has again broken all boundaries and created a visible extravaganza that allows you to have audiences running to the cinema halls! “Titanic” first released in 1997 and is likely one of the greatest love stories of all time, winning 11 Oscars that year.

The artistic strategy of re-visualizing TITANIC in three dimensions was overseen entirely by Cameron himself, with his long-time producing partner Jon Landau – who both pushed the conversion company Stereo D literally to unprecedented visual breadth. Says Cameron, “The 3D enriches all of TITANIC’s most thrilling moments — and its most emotional moments. We get to bring Titanic back to the large screen after having been gone for 15 years. I’ve always considered watching this film in theaters as a social phenomenon, where parents will take their children or teenagers would go along with their mom. I’m a robust believer within the theatrical experience in general, but specificallyfor this film.”

About Titanic 3D releasing on 5th April 2012Directed by James CameronProduced by James Cameron & Jon LandauStarring: Leonardo DiCaprio, Kate Winslet and Billy ZaneStudio: FOX STAR STUDIOS

Titanic is an American epic romance and disaster film directed, written, co-produced, and co-edited by James Cameron.A fictionalized account of the sinking of the RMS Titanic, it stars Leonardo DiCaprio as Jack Dawson, Kate Winsletas Rose DeWitt Bukater, Gloria Stuart as Old Rose, and Billy Zane as Rose’s fiancé, Cal Hockley. Jack and Roseare members of various social classes who fall in love aboard the ship during its ill-fated maiden voyage. In 1997, James Cameron’s TITANIC set sail in theaters and one of the vital world’s most breathtaking and timeless love storieswas born.

The film’s journey became a world phenomenon as vast as its name, garnering a record number ofAcademy Award nominations, 11 Academy Awards and grossing over $1.8 billion worldwide.

On April 5th, 2012, precisely a century after the historic ship’s sinking and 15 years after the film’s initialtheatrical release, TITANIC resurfaces in theaters in state-of-the-art 3D.

About Fox Star Studios India Fox STAR Studios is a three way partnership between Twentieth Century Fox, one of the vital world’s largest producers and distributors of movies and STAR, Asia’s leading media company Fox STAR Studios will combine the production and distribution capabilities of 20th Century Fox and the local expertise and market strength of STAR in Asia to provide Asian language films through acquisitions, co-productions and in-house productions for worldwide distribution. It'll even have access to the remake rights of successful films from both the Fox and STAR libraries. The three way partnership is making its first foray in India and can soon expand into other markets including Greater China and South East Asia.

Fox STAR Studios has also built a countrywide theatrical distribution footprint and can soon deal with distribution capabilities in home entertainment and digital media platform in India while also leveraging Fox Theatrical Network’s global distribution strength across 44 countries worldwide.
